OPPO Find N Specs

Description

The OPPO Find N is the first foldable smartphone of the company and it comes with 7.1-inch AMOLED display with 120Hz refresh rate when unfolded. When it's folded there is a 5.49-inch AMOLED display with Gorilla Glass Victus protection. Specs also include Qualcomm Snapdragon 888 processor, 4500mAh battery with 33W fast charging and triple camera setup on the back with 50MP main sensor.

High quality foldable for people that cant manage big sized phones
Phone owned for less than a month

The Oppo Find N is probable the most premium build foldable yet with a well thought through form factor. You get a device smaller than a Pixel 5. Thickness is managable easily and the weight is less noticable than expected. If you want this device for movies or netflix primerily, consider a Z Flip as you wont get real estate in terms of screen size. Main usecases unfolded are gaming, fotos, Reading papers or browsing the web.
